Meet John Doe (en Argentina y en España, Juan Nadie; en Venezuela, ¿Conocen a John Doe?) es una película estadounidense de 1941 dirigida y producida por Frank Capra, y con Gary Cooper y Barbara Stanwyck como actores principales.
Meet John Doe is a 1941 American comedy drama film directed and produced by Frank Capra, written by Robert Riskin, and starring Gary Cooper, Barbara Stanwyck and Edward Arnold. A down-on-his-luck homeless man (Gary Cooper) is hired by a major newspaper to be the voice behind a fictional protest letter about society's ills and in the process a nationwide social movement is begun that culminates with the threat of a leap from the roof of City Hall on a cold Christmas Eve night. — statusreport.
